What did Thomas Paine help make clear to colonists in his pamphlet Common Sense?

Respuesta :

brightstar1080
brightstar1080 brightstar1080
  • 02-04-2021

Answer:

Thomas Paine was advocating for the colonists to fight for independence — that it is common sense to have independence from Great Britain.
